Understanding Fabric Damage and Its Causes
Before exploring how modern laundry systems prevent damage, it’s important to understand what causes it. Common factors include excessive heat, rough drum movement, overloading, high spin speeds, and strong detergent use. Traditional machines lacked the intelligence to adapt cycles based on fabric sensitivity, leading to wear, pilling, and color loss. In contrast, advanced machines now incorporate multiple sensors and customizable cycles that minimize these risks.
How Modern Laundry Systems Protect Fabrics
Today’s laundry appliances use a combination of design innovation and smart technology to prevent fabric damage. Below are some of the most effective features that contribute to gentler washing and longer garment life.
1. Smart Drum Design
Drum design plays a vital role in fabric care. Modern washers feature smooth, wave-shaped drums with tiny perforations that reduce friction between fabrics and metal surfaces. This design creates a gentle cushioning effect during washing and spinning, preventing fiber stretching or tearing. The drum’s structure also improves water distribution for thorough yet soft cleaning.
2. Sensor-Based Load Detection
Advanced load sensors measure the weight and size of each laundry batch and automatically adjust water levels, drum movement, and cycle duration. By optimizing these settings, the machine prevents over-agitation and excessive spinning that can damage delicate materials. Proper load balance also ensures even cleaning and reduced fabric stress.
3. Controlled Spin and Motion Technology
Instead of one standard spin pattern, modern machines use multiple motion types such as rolling, stepping, and tumbling. These patterns mimic hand-washing techniques, allowing fabrics to move gently in water. Low-speed spins and smooth transitions between cycles reduce stretching and deformation, particularly for fragile textiles like wool, chiffon, or lace.
4. Precise Temperature Regulation
Heat can cause shrinkage, fading, or distortion in sensitive fabrics. Temperature control systems in advanced machines monitor and maintain optimal levels during washing and drying. By ensuring the water never exceeds safe limits, these systems protect natural fibers like cotton, silk, and linen from thermal damage while still ensuring proper cleaning.
5. Automatic Detergent Dispensing
Excess detergent can leave residue on fabrics and weaken fibers over time. Machines with automatic detergent dispensers measure the exact amount needed based on the load and soil level. This prevents overuse of chemicals and maintains fabric softness and elasticity after repeated washes.
6. Gentle Wash Programs for Delicates
Specialized wash programs are tailored for specific fabric types. “Delicate,” “wool,” or “hand-wash” cycles use slower drum motions, lower water temperatures, and reduced spin speeds. These settings replicate manual washing methods, keeping sensitive materials safe while ensuring thorough cleaning.
7. Steam-Assisted Cleaning
Steam technology softens fibers, relaxes wrinkles, and removes stains without harsh agitation. The gentle action of steam helps disinfect clothes while maintaining fabric texture. It also minimizes the need for high temperatures, making it ideal for preventing shrinkage and preserving color quality.
8. Anti-Tangle and Reverse Motion Systems
Tangled clothes can twist and stretch under high-speed spinning. Anti-tangle technology uses reverse drum motion to keep garments separated and reduce mechanical stress. This helps prevent shape distortion, particularly in long garments like dresses or trousers.
9. Moisture and Dryness Sensors
Over-drying can cause fibers to become brittle and weak. Modern dryers include moisture sensors that detect the exact dryness level and automatically stop the cycle when fabrics are ready. This prevents overexposure to heat and ensures that clothes remain soft and smooth.
10. Soft Drum Paddles
New-generation machines use flexible paddles or lifters that gently lift and drop clothes instead of aggressively tumbling them. This controlled movement reduces friction, helping maintain the original quality of fabric textures, prints, and embellishments.
11. Automatic Water Level Control
Different fabrics require different water levels to ensure safe washing. Automatic water control systems measure the load and adjust water intake accordingly. This prevents the over-soaking or under-rinsing that can damage fibers, ensuring every wash is balanced and effective.
12. Smooth Start and Stop Cycles
Machines with soft-start motors prevent sudden jolts during operation. Instead of immediately reaching full speed, they gradually accelerate and decelerate, reducing strain on fabrics and internal components. This feature helps preserve clothing shape and reduces stress on zippers and buttons.
13. Eco-Friendly Rinse and Spin Cycles
Eco rinse options use minimal yet adequate water and gentle motion to remove detergent residues. Cleaner rinsing not only benefits skin sensitivity but also prevents long-term fiber weakening. Low-impact spin cycles maintain efficiency while reducing mechanical wear.
14. Smart Fabric Recognition
Some advanced washers are equipped with fabric recognition sensors that identify material types and adjust the wash automatically. This ensures each garment receives the proper combination of temperature, motion, and detergent, protecting even the most delicate pieces from unnecessary stress.
15. Air-Dry and Heat Pump Drying Systems
Traditional dryers often rely on high heat, which can cause shrinkage or fading. Air-dry and heat pump systems use warm air circulation at lower temperatures, ensuring gentle drying. These methods retain the softness and structure of fabrics while consuming less energy.

Maintaining Fabric-Friendly Performance
To keep your equipment functioning at its best, regular maintenance is key. Cleaning the drum, filters, and detergent compartments helps maintain performance. Avoid overloading and always use the recommended wash cycles for different materials. With proper care, modern laundry machines can deliver reliable fabric protection for years.
